4.2 Membership at the core - member support

Technical Support - Members tend to cite a key benefit of membership is the technical support and guidance we provide.

Technical Webinars

Following the circulation of technical updates, the BWF hosts “a drop-in facility” for members to speak directly to the technical team – 12 technical drop in webinars were held in in 2024 with 80+ individuals “talking technical” through 2024.

In-person technical meetings

Two in person “technical” focused meetings were held for members = 87 registrations, 98% attendance

Effective Business Support

Members can access a variety of business support services - HR, H&S, Legal/Contractual and general business support services.

Publication Downloads

9635 publications, factsheets and guidance documents downloaded in 2024

New Heritage and Conservation WG

Formed in 2024, the new Heritage and Conservation Working Group identified key BWF factsheets and publications that needed to be reviewed and updated. The first -Fact Card 1- What is a Listed Building was released in December 2024. Historic England - We completed the Heritage Skills Programme with Historic England which resulted in the ‘Skills Needs Analysis for the Repair, Maintenance and Retrofit of Traditional (Pre 1919) Buildings in England 2024’ report. This was published in September 2024
